About

The Bell is a historic pub in Warwickshire, the West Midlands — listed in heritage records for its surviving fabric, fittings or trading history. It sits within the Stratford-on-Avon parliamentary constituency. The nearest railway station is Danzey, about 1.3 km away. Postcode area B94.
